President Klaus Iohannis will welcome Victoria Nuland, US Deputy Secretary of State for European and Eurasian Affairs, on Monday, at 02:00 pm, at the Cotroceni Palace, the Presidential Administration informs.
Victoria Nuland will arrive in Bucharest on Sunday, and at 08:00 pm she will meet Prime Minister Dacian Ciolos.
Official sources have told Agerpres that, in an informal dinner, Prime Minister Dacian Ciolos will unveil to the US official present the priorities of his Government.
Also, the two will discuss improving the investments climate in Romania, the situation in the region, particularly in Moldova, but also about the relations with Ukraine and Russia.
The US Embassy in Bucharest has informed, this week, at AGERPRES' request, that Victoria Nuland will pay a visit to Romania, where she will meet President Klaus Iohannis and Prime Minister Dacian Ciolos.
"Victoria Nuland, US Assistant Secretary of State for European Affairs and Eurasian Affairs, will meet President Iohannis, Premier Ciolos and other representatives of the new Government to discuss bilateral issues of common interest within our strategic Partnership," said the US Embassy in Bucharest.
